Commerce : Council Will Meet Earlier
- Share via
The City Council has approved an ordinance to start their bimonthly meetings an hour earlier at 7 p.m.
The new starting time will take effect at the council’s April 6 meeting, said City Clerk Linda Finckbone, who added that change was made so the meetings would end earlier as a public convenience.
The council meets the first and third Mondays of every month.
